The Opportunity

Are you ready to assume ownership of our high‑stakes semiconductor category, commanding worldwide foundry alliances and insulating our life‑saving medical systems from market disruptions? As our Global Category Manager for Semiconductors in the US, you will take ultimate accountability for developing strategies and leading strategic initiatives for this volatile, high‑stakes spend category. In this role, you will manage silicon foundries, chip designers, and global distributors, mitigate geopolitical supply risks, and translate category goals into long‑term value and supply continuity.

  • Reporting Line:
    Directly reports to the Senior Global Category Lead Electronics & Systems within the Category organization.

  • Wider Team and Stakeholders:
    Engages directly with cross‑functional teams composed of representatives from Category, Delivery, Procurement Center of Excellence, and global business partners. Serves as a key business partner contact point for senior functional and business stakeholders.

  • Role Type:
    An Individual Contributor role with global category leadership position focused on strategic vision, category development, pipeline building, and relationship ecosystem management

  • Impact:
    You deliver commercial impact by anchoring cost and developing a resilience pipeline of projects, in addition to securing our sustainability priorities. Specifically, you are accountable for:
    • Strategy & Annual Pipeline:
      Collating market intelligence, supplier data, and business requirements to formulate a formalized, global Category Strategy and initiative pipeline, to be aligned with leaders across the organization.
    • Commercial Negotiations:
      Leading high‑value commercial and contractual negotiations for strategic suppliers within the category.
    • Supplier Ecosystems:
      Managing key global suppliers, establishing development and innovation programs, monitoring value targets, and managing supplier risks.
    • Guidance & Content:
      Developing and maintaining category guidance documents to translate strategy into clear, executable content for procurement colleagues and business users.
    • Business Partnering:
      Building deep relationships with senior stakeholders, challenging demand/specifications to maximize value, and managing risk/CSR reviews.
    • Team & Budget Oversight:
      Coaching procurement colleagues, providing professional development, managing a shared Associate Category Manager within the team, and tracking budget spend.
